LPL Protein — Lipoprotein Lipase

🔬 Protein Info
Gene SymbolLPL
Full NameLipoprotein Lipase
AliasesLPLPROTEIN
Protein TypeEnzyme
FunctionLipoprotein Lipase (LPL) is a key enzyme in lipid metabolism that hydrolyzes triglycerides in circulating lipoproteins, primarily chylomicrons and very-low-density lipoproteins (VLDL).
